Saddles & Sequins Gala
This fundraising event is sponsored by nonprofit Family Hope Fulshear, which provides food, furniture, education, financial assistance and special events to families in need in northern Fort Bend County. The country-meets-couture-themed event takes place at Beckendorff Farms and will feature a buffet, open wine bar, auctions, boot shining, boot scooting and live music.
